      DESCRIPTION:

      Duties: Consult with stakeholders to determine system requirements and document acceptance criteria into user stories. Configure customized system solutions that meet business needs and specifications. Perform detailed analysis on multiple projects, recommend potential business solutions and ensure successful implementations. Act as a liaison to the end users, internal partner applications vendors and engineers. Analyze current architecture of the application and provide suggestions and approach to be taken to meet the requirement for the enhancement, business requirement or regulatory changes. Create the architectural diagram and detailed design document to support the enhancement and new requirements and collaborate with cross-functional teams like Architects, Data Base Administrators, Testers and Operations Teams to support the changes and obtain specific requirements. Integrate process and code changes worked upon by different teams. Support the development and testing teams for the changes being completed as the subject matter expert for the project. Utilize technical skillset to write requirements, write functional test cases, develop and execute tests when needed. Participate in end-to-end reviews for the project in order to comply with Global Change Management Policies for application changes being planned as Subject Matter Expert and review to fulfill various Audit and Compliance requirements. Drive decisions regarding data flows and document data flows for use by all stakeholders. Develop and execute functional test cases. Understand and drive project timelines within the core project team, but also with external partners. Coordinate and Drive partner development and testing. Maintain project documents for traceability and audits.


      QUALIFICATIONS:

      Minimum education and experience required: Master’s deg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, Computer Information Systems, or related field of study plus 1 year of experience in the job offered or as Business Analyst, Developer User Interface, IT Administrator, or related occupation.

      Skills Required: Requires experience in the following: Scrum methodologies; Backlog administration; Backlog refinement; Sprint planning; Sprint reviews; Retrospectives address; Remove blockers; Developing test code; KAFKA connectivity; Java; Rest Controller in spring framework; RESTful web service; JSON objects for communication; Writing Junit test cases; Kubernetes; Jenkins Pipeline; RESTful API for HTTP request; and GIT.
